How Our Shower Pan Leak Water Removal Service Actually Works
Properly addressing a leaky shower pan needs a systematic approach. Our team starts by inspecting your bathroom, identifying the source of the leak, and assessing the damage. We then use specialized equipment to remove standing water and dry out the affected area.
Step 1: Inspection and Assessment
We’ll carefully examine your shower pan to find out the cause of the leak and assess the extent of the damage.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and ensuring a successful restoration process. Our trained technicians are experienced in identifying hidden water damage and hidden leaks.
Step 2: Water Removal
Our team uses specialized equipment to extract standing water from your bathroom, including wet/dry vacuum extractors and dehumidifiers. This helps prevent mold growth and reduces the risk of further damage.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
We use industrial-grade dehumidifiers to remove excess moisture from the air and speed up the drying process. This helps prevent secondary water damage and reduces the risk of mold growth.
Step 4: Repair and Restoration
Our team will repair or replace the damaged shower pan, ensuring a watertight seal and a lasting repair. We use high-quality materials and construction techniques to ensure a durable and long-lasting repair.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Cleaning
We’ll conduct a final inspection to ensure the job is complete and the area is safe and clean. We’ll also provide a comprehensive report outlining the work completed and any recommendations for future maintenance.

Warning Signs You Need Shower Pan Leak Water Removal
Ignoring the warning signs of a leaky shower pan can lead to costly repairs and even health risks. Here are some common signs to look out for: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, unpleasant odors can be a sign of hidden water damage or mold growth. If you notice a musty smell in your bathroom, don’t ignore it, contact our team today.
Water Stains or Warping on the Ceiling
Water stains or warping on the ceiling above your bathroom can be a sign of a leaky shower pan. Don’t wait until the damage is extensive, contact our team today to schedule an inspection.
Peeling or Buckling of the Shower Pan
Peeling or buckling of the shower pan can be a sign of water damage or poor installation. Contact our team today to schedule a repair or replacement.
Water Leaks or Puddles on the Floor
Visible water leaks or puddles on the floor can be a sign of a leaky shower pan. Don’t ignore it, contact our team today to schedule a repair.
Discoloration or Warping of the Surrounding Materials
Discoloration or warping of the surrounding materials, such as drywall or wood, can be a sign of water damage or poor installation. Contact our team today to schedule a repair or replacement.
Excessive Moisture or Humidity in the Bathroom
Excessive moisture or humidity in the bathroom can be a sign of a leaky shower pan or poor ventilation. Don’t ignore it, contact our team today to schedule an inspection.

Shower Pan Leak Water Removal Cost in Lancaster, TX
The cost of Shower Pan Leak Water Removal in Lancaster, TX can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ide a free estimate to help you understand the costs involved.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Initial Inspection and Assessment | $100 – $500 | The severity of the damage and the size of the affected area |
| Water Removal and Drying | $500 – $2,500 | The amount of water involved and the complexity of the job |
| Repair or Replacement of the Shower Pan | $1,000 – $5,000 | The type of materials used and the complexity of the repair or replacement |
| Final Inspection and Cleaning | $100 – $500 | The extent of the work completed and the type of materials used |
